Ingo Molnar wrote:
> On Sun, 6 Oct 2002, Dave Hansen wrote:
>
>>cc'ing Ingo, because I think this might be related to the timer bh
>>removal.
>
> could you try the attached patch against 2.5.41, does it help? It fixes
> the bugs found so far plus makes del_timer_sync() a bit more robust by
> re-checking timer pending-ness before exiting. There is one type of code
> that might have relied on this kind of behavior of the old timer code.
Well, I gave it a shot. I haven't seen any more of the __run_timers
oopses yet, but I haven't been able to stay up for very long before it
freezes, so time will tell. But, for now, I'm pretty sure that it is
quite a bit better.
